Job Title: Mechanical Design Lead

Location

Preston (3 days in office per week - must be commutable to Preston)

Salary

£50,000-£65,000 per annum (depending on experience)

  • Company car

Working Hours

40 hours per week - flexible start/finish times (typically between 07:00-18:30)

About Us

We are a values-driven, charitable engineering organisation where profits are donated to charities chosen by our employees. We pride ourselves on a supportive, collaborative culture and are committed to both personal and professional development.

Role Overview

We are seeking a Mechanical Design Lead to join our team and play a key role in delivering projects within the UU framework for AMP8 and beyond. You will be responsible for producing high-quality mechanical design drawings, coordinating with multi-disciplinary teams, and leading site surveys with clients. As a design lead, you will also review engineering drawings, guide and mentor team members, and ensure technical excellence throughout the design process.

Key Responsibilities

  • Create detailed mechanical design drawings in accordance with project guidelines and standards.

  • Lead and review mechanical design deliverables, ensuring accuracy and compliance.

  • Liaise effectively with internal stakeholders, multi-disciplinary teams, site engineers, and clients.

  • Conduct and lead site surveys to gather essential project information.

  • Provide technical support and mentorship to design team members.

  • Communicate confidently with stakeholders across all levels to capture project requirements and resolve queries.

  • Support project documentation, including P&IDs, MCC & control panel layouts, piping layouts, and other design deliverables.

Skills & Experience Required

  • Proven experience in mechanical design engineering.

  • Strong communicator - a "people person" able to work confidently with a variety of personalities and stakeholder groups.

  • Experience leading teams and supporting technical queries.

  • Extensive exposure to the water treatment or wastewater industries is essential.

  • Experience working for a design and build contractor (preferably Tier 1).

  • Comfortable liaising with clients to efficiently capture project requirements.

  • A proactive self-starter with excellent organisational skills.

  • Senior level proficiency in AutoCAD (Mechanical).

  • Experience with mechanical design activities including P&IDs, control panels, MCCs, piping layouts, and associated documentation.
